The typical American commute has been getting longer each year since 2010. The average one-way commute in Allamuchy township takes 40.8 minutes. That's longer than the US average of 26.4 minutes.

How people in Allamuchy township get to work:
- 77.7% drive their own car alone
- 5.5% carpool with others
- 15.0% work from home
- 0.7% take mass transit
